Controlling humidity levels, leaks, and poor ventilation are common causes of mold problems in HVAC systems. High humidity can lead to condensation within ducts, creating the perfect environment for mold to thrive. Leaky ductwork, broken seals, and insufficient filtration can also introduce moisture and organic material that support mold growth. Ignoring these issues can lead to extensive contamination that affects your entire property.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the signs of mold in my HVAC system?

Indications include musty odors coming from vents, visible mold growth on duct surfaces, increased allergy symptoms, or unexplained respiratory issues. Regular inspection can help catch problems early before they worsen.

Is mold in HVAC dangerous?

Yes, mold spores can cause respiratory problems, allergies, and other health issues, especially for sensitive individuals. Proper removal and remediation are essential for maintaining a safe indoor environment.

How long does HVAC mold remediation take?

The duration varies depending on the extent of mold growth and system complexity. Typically, a thorough remediation can take from one to three days. Our team will provide a clear estimate after inspection.

Can I clean mold from my HVAC system myself?

While minor contamination might be manageable, professional remediation ensures thorough removal and eliminates hidden mold. DIY efforts often miss concealed spores and can lead to recurring issues.

How can I prevent mold growth in my HVAC system?

Maintaining low humidity, fixing leaks promptly, and scheduling regular duct cleaning can significantly reduce mold risk. Our experts also recommend installing proper ventilation and moisture barriers for long-term mold prevention.
